Call For Papers - Deadline: February 15, 2024
Invitation to submit:
We are looking for contributions on the broad theme of economic development. Topics of interest include but are not limited to: education and health; entrepreneurship and private sector development; financial inclusion; international migration and refugees; natural resource management; public service provision and political economy; technology adoption in low-income countries.
Submission guidelines and timetable:
Submissions of full papers (pdf files) are expected by February 15, 2024. Extended abstracts may also be submitted but priority will be given to full papers. Decisions will be made by March 4, 2024, at which time conference registration will open.

Travel to Carcavelos campus
Airplane
The easiest way to come to Lisbon is by airplane to the Lisbon airport. The easiest way to get from the airport to the Nova campus in Carcavelos is by Taxi or Uber. It is a 30Km journey that costs up to 35 EUR by taxi.
Car
If you arrive by car, you can use the campus parking or park for free in the campus’ surrounding areas.
Train
You can travel overnight by train. There are trains connecting Madrid (Lusitânia Comboio Hotel), Vigo (Celta train) and Irun (Sud Expresso) to Lisbon. From the city center you can take a train to the Nova Carcavelos campus. This train leaves from the station “Cais do Sodré” to either the “Oeiras” or the “Carcavelos” train station and takes approximately 35 minutes. From the Oeiras train station it is a 20 minute walk to the campus. It is 25 minute walk or 5 minute ride with the MobiCascais shuttle from the train station in Carcavelos.
